This might not be bots reposting auctions, because keep in mind, listing an auction costs money. If you were to repost to undercut by 1c each time someone undercut YOU, you’d be constantly losing out money really fast.

What the AH bots ACTUALLY do is scan for accidental lowball auctions where people accidentally miss a 0 in their listing and post something tor 10x less than its worth, and they instantly snipe it. Then they relist that for a normal price.
